When should I add nutes to DWC?

StickyLafleur
StickyLafleurstarted grow question 5y ago
Should I wait until the roots emerge from the bottom of my net pot before adding nutrients? 5 gallon DWC, started germination on 1/1. Shes been sitting in dwc with just water for 2 days. Planning to use dynagro grow at 1/4 recommended dosage to start.

Begin nutes sometime in between the second and third week. You can use Silica and beneficials like Hydroguard beforehand, but no NPK nutes. Side note: you have some twisted beginning growth. In my experience, this has been from letting the cubes get too wet. This puts your root system off to a bad start. You also have a trileaf mutation, which for me resulted in a huge final plant.
